I came to celebrate a birthday. The address is Blagden Alley, it is really in an alley. Calico is a cute and cozy establishment. I ordered the Green Goddess Pasta and my husband had the Pit Beef platter. They were both delicious. There is a drink on the menu called the Creamsicle. I am not a drinker and asked for a nonalcoholic version. It tasted like an Orange Julius but more grown up. It was very creamy and refreshing. The day I was there it was extremely hot. The feel like temperature outside reached over 100 degrees. The staff kept your water glasses full from the time you entered till you left. The staff was so friendly and customer service orientated. They checked on you without being overbearing. I also liked that music was not too loud. The bathrooms were very clean. I want to go back and try their loaded tater tots.

Too late! This hidden gem is no longer hidden. But this open-air bar centered around a garden-like patio and warehouse-style interior offers yummy draft cocktails, friendly staff, and great summer vibes. Perhaps upscale — both the menu and the crowd are dead giveaways — but probably worth the splurge. Volume is just right for good conversation — perfect date spot. Art, bingo, and grill nights during the week; $3 tomato pie slices(?) and $2 off (not am amazing deal) for HH. Definitely try the Lavender Lemonade. But uh...plastic forks?
